How far is TAR from DGL?

The flight distance from Grottaglie (TAR) to Douglas (DGL) is 6,424 miles (10,339 km, 5,583 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from TAR to DGL?

A nonstop flight takes about 13h 4m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Grottaglie and Douglas?

Douglas is 9 hours behind Grottaglie.
